Responsibilities :

  • Assess each call situation to determine the best course of action while adhering to progressive Paramedic protocols in a busy 911 system.
  • Utilize your advanced Paramedic skills in a supportive medical environment.
  • Communicate effectively with patients and their families, providing reassurance and care information.
  • Lead your team on scene, managing both the unit and patient needs as required.
  • Collaborate professionally with allied health and public safety personnel.

Minimum Qualifications :

  • High school diploma or equivalent (GED).
  • Current State Paramedic License.
  • Valid State Driver's License.
  • BLS, ACLS, PALS, and PHTLS (or ITLS) certifications.
  • Driving record that meets company standards.
  • Ability to pass Physical Agility Test.
  • Some work experience, preferably in healthcare.
